:HCOPy:DEVice:PRESet<1|2> ON | OFF
This command resets the hardcopy unit (1 or 2) prior to generating the hardcopy (FSE without
controller or with DOS controller only)
Example: ":HCOP:DEV:PRES2 ON"
Features: *RST value: OFF
SCPI: device-specific
Modes: A, VA, BTS, MS
:HCOPy:DEVice:RESolution<1|2> 150 | 300
This command controls the resolution of the printout in PCL4 and HP-deskjet format (hardcopy unit 1
or 2) (FSE without controller or with DOS controller only).
Example: ":HCOP:DEV:RES 300"
Features: *RST value: 150
SCPI: conforming
Modes: A, VA, BTS, MS
The resolution for an output in PCL4 format is between 150 dpi or 300 dpi.
:HCOPy[:IMMediate<1|2>]
This command starts a hardcopy output.
Example: "HCOP"
Features: *RST value: -
SCPI: conforming
Modes: A, VA, BTS, MS
HCOP[1] starts the hardcopy output to device 1 (default), HCOP2 starts the output to device 2.
This command is an event which is why it is not assigned an *RST value and has no query.
:HCOPy:ITEM:ALL
This command selects the complete screen to be output.
Example: ":HCOP:ITEM:ALL"
Features: *RST value: OFF
SCPI: conforming
Modes: A, VA, BTS, MS
The hardcopy output is always provided with comments, title, time and date. As an alternative to the
whole screen, only traces (commands ’:HCOPy:DEVice:WINDow:TRACe: STATe ON’) or tables
(command ’:HCOPy:DEVice:WINDow:TABLe:STATe ON’) can be output.
